发表于:2006-01-12 14:18:00
楼主
求助:s7-200与浙大中控DCS系统通讯:
通讯接口采用RS485接口,该线为红、黑两芯线。
硬件通讯协议:9600,E,8,1
S7-200 PLC
内部地自定义:以字节为单位
定义 地址
1000(字节) 1#站标尺状态
1001(字节) 1#站通讯状态
1002~1003(字节) 1#站车地址编码
1004(字节) 2#站标尺状态
1005(字节) 2#站通讯状态
1006~1007(字节) 2#站车地址编码
1008(字节) 3#站标尺状态
1009(字节) 3#站通讯状态
1010~1011(字节) 3#站车地址编码
使用Modbus协议中的三号指令。站地址为1
注:如果通讯状态为1,说明该站通讯已经失败,其他字节状态将会保留为当前值,不会改变。
所以要判断当前标尺状态是否正常,首先须确定该站通讯状态是否正常。
主站PLC的Q1.5、Q1.6、Q1.7是1#站、2#站、3#站通讯状态的标志位,1=通讯失败
浙大中控的通讯卡是SP244,也是通过RS485连接,请教有谁做过内似的通讯?由于本人不才,初次接触与PLC的通讯,有些不知如何下手。请不吝赐教!感激不尽!!
qq:305059726
hero2245@sina.com.cn